(1) Subject to subsection (3), a specified officer may exercise powers under this Division in relation to a prisoner on parole if authorised to do so by the Commissioner.
(2) The Commissioner may authorise a specified officer to exercise powers under this Division if the Commissioner believes on reasonable grounds that the supervision of the prisoner on parole would otherwise pose a high risk of violence or other threat to the safety of any person engaged in that supervision or to any other person.
(3) A specified officer may exercise powers under this Division—
(a) when engaged in the supervision of the prisoner on parole or assisting in that supervision; and
(b) in accordance with any direction given by the Commissioner.

(4) The powers that may be exercised by a specified officer under this Division are in addition to any powers the specified officer may exercise under this Act or the Serious Offenders Act 2018 .
